技术栈
递归:一个图教学会递归原理
期待粉红笔记本
2023-07-29 13:02
递归的特点
实际上,递归有两个显著的特征,终止条件和自身调用:
自身调用:原问题可以分解为子问题,子问题和原问题的求解方法是一致的,即都是调用自身的同一个函数。
终止条件:递归必须有一个终止的条件,即不能无限循环地调用本身。
递归的原理
数据结构
算法
上一篇:
Vue+Element ui Study
下一篇:
【C++ 进阶】学习导论:C/C++ 进阶学习路线、大纲与目标
相关推荐
盼海
4 分钟前
排序算法(五)--归并排序
数据结构
·
算法
·
排序算法
网易独家音乐人Mike Zhou
3 小时前
【卡尔曼滤波】数据预测Prediction观测器的理论推导及应用 C语言、Python实现(Kalman Filter)
c语言
·
python
·
单片机
·
物联网
·
算法
·
嵌入式
·
iot
搬砖的小码农_Sky
6 小时前
C语言:数组
c语言
·
数据结构
Swift社区
7 小时前
LeetCode - #139 单词拆分
算法
·
leetcode
·
职场和发展
Kent_J_Truman
8 小时前
greater<>() 、less<>()及运算符 < 重载在排序和堆中的使用
算法
先鱼鲨生
8 小时前
数据结构——栈、队列
数据结构
一念之坤
8 小时前
零基础学Python之数据结构 -- 01篇
数据结构
·
python
IT 青年
8 小时前
数据结构 (1)基本概念和术语
数据结构
·
算法
熬夜学编程的小王
8 小时前
【初阶数据结构篇】双向链表的实现(赋源码)
数据结构
·
c++
·
链表
·
双向链表
Dong雨
8 小时前
力扣hot100-->栈/单调栈
算法
·
leetcode
·
职场和发展
热门推荐
01
(欧拉)openEuler系统添加网卡文件配置流程、(欧拉)openEuler系统手动配置ipv6地址流程、(欧拉)openEuler系统网络管理说明
02
PyTorch机器学习实现液态神经网络
03
【HarmonyOS】HUAWEI DevEco Studio 下载地址汇总
04
玄机平台应急响应—webshell查杀
05
Coze扣子平台完整体验和实践(附国内和国际版对比)
06
Ubuntu 20.04使用Livox mid 360 测试 FAST_LIO
07
【目标跟踪】相机运动补偿
08
Unity中PICO实现 隔空取物 和 接触抓取物体
09
RAG 实践- Ollama+RagFlow 部署本地知识库
10
怎样让音频速度变慢?请跟随以下方法进行操作